Patent number: 10316841Abstract: An object of the invention is to provide a compressor that includes a corrosion-resistant film formed on the surface of a casing having a complicated shape. A compressor pumps gas in a compression chamber formed by a casing, the casing is made of cast iron, and a layer made of a mixture of iron nitride and a compound of iron, nitrogen, and carbon and an oxide layer made of triiron tetraoxide are formed on the surface of the casing. Accordingly, since the corrosion resistance of the casing, which includes a film formed by a gas soft-nitriding treatment and an oxidation treatment, is improved, the generation of rust is suppressed. Therefore, it is possible to provide a compressor in which galling or sticking caused by rust occurs less.Type: GrantFiled: October 23, 2015Date of Patent: June 11, 2019Assignee: Hitachi Industrial Equipment Systems Co., Ltd.Inventors: Yukiko Ikeda, Masakatsu Okaya, Yuuichi Yanagase

Patent number: 9944880Abstract: In order to prevent deterioration in performance of an oil-free screw compressor and scuffing caused by rust, surfaces of both male and female rotors are coated with heat-resistance coatings containing a solid lubricant. A coating contains Polyimide resin to which Molybdenum disulfide, as a solid lubricant, and Aluminum oxide and Titanium oxide, as additives, are added. Accordingly, it is possible to realize a coating that is higher in heat resistance and longer in lifetime than a conventional one.Type: GrantFiled: July 7, 2014Date of Patent: April 17, 2018Assignees: HITACHI INDUSTRIAL EQUIPMENT SYSTEMS CO., LTD., KAWAMURA RESEARCH LABORATORIES, INC.Inventors: Yukiko Ikeda, Kazuaki Shiinoki, Masakatsu Okaya, Natsuki Kawabata, Masahiro Kawamura, Iwao Aoki
